%X This paper presents an object-oriented approach for creating multi-region non-manifold models with NURBS. The main motivation is that geometry and shape of realistic engineering objects are intrinsically complex, usually composed by several materials and regions. Therefore, automatic and/or adaptive meshing algorithms have been turned quite useful to increase the reliability of the procedures of a FEM numerical analysis. The present approach is then concerned with two aspects of 3D FEM simulation: geometric modeling, with automatic multi-region detection, and support to automatic finite element mesh generation. The final objective is to use geometric models directly in numerical applications
